Forget Yourself

Released

Following the lengthy multi-session assembly of After Everything Now This, the Church went the jam-it-out-and-see-what-happens mode for Forget Yourself, a noisier affair in comparison to its predecessor while retaining the same sense of easy confidence in approach overall. Both Peter Koppes and Marty Willson-Piper each get a vocal feature, on “See Your Lights” and “Appalatia” respectively, while the appropriately trippy chug of “Song In Space,” the Beach Boys harmonies on “Telepath” and the yearning melancholy of “Maya” are just three of the many highlights.
